Xavier Driencourt: "Why Should We Read the Parliamentary Report on Algerian Immigration to France"

Summary by Le Figaro
TRIBUNE - The report by the two Macroists Charles Rodwell and Mathieu Lefèvre on the 1968 Franco-Algérien agreement is astounding, points out the diplomat. It shows that Algerians benefit from an exceptional and derogatory arrangement at all stages of the migration journey.
